Prime Dallas Neighborhoods with Highest Demand for Quick Home Sales
Various Dallas residential areas are distinguished for their fast sales cycles and high buyer competition. These neighborhoods are well-known for their desirability, accessibility, and excellent local amenities, turning them into ideal locations for quick home turnovers.
Lakewood: Renowned for its appealing homes and excellent school districts, Lakewood appeals to families and professionals in search of mature community vibes and easy access to downtown Dallas. Bishop Arts District: This energetic urban neighborhood merges trendy dining and shopping with historic charm, appealing to young buyers and investors who appreciate walkability and cultural appeal. Oak Lawn: Oak Lawn is favored for urban living with a vibrant nightlife scene and proximity to key employment hubs, drawing first-time buyers and cash buyers focused on quick property flips.
Preston Hollow: Characterized by luxurious residences and large lots, Preston Hollow entices well-off buyers desiring luxury paired with privacy, amplifying demand for quick transactions. Plano (Dallas suburbs): Suburban neighborhoods like Plano have witnessed rising demand due to minimal property taxes, established schools, and commuter-friendly locations.
These neighborhoods consistently report elevated offer acceptance rates and briefer closing timelines compared to other regions of Dallas, powered by an competitive market and constrained housing supply.

How Economic Factors Affect Quick Home Sales in Dallas
Economic variables such as mortgage rates, employment growth, and overall housing affordability affect buyer behavior in Dallas. Rising mortgage rates generally heighten urgency among buyers seeking to secure loans before further hikes.
Vibrant local job markets and population growth lead to neighborhood expansion and rising property values, encouraging quicker home turnovers. Conversely, economic uncertainty can impede sales as buyers become cautious or wait for market stabilization.
